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Pasadena

Finding an LGBTQIA+-affirming therapist in Pasadena, TX starts with knowing what to look for. An affirming provider does more than accept your identity — they understand the specific stressors that LGBTQIA+ individuals may face, including experiences related to coming out, discrimination, family dynamics, and identity exploration. Look for a licensed provider (such as an LPC, LCSW, psychologist, or psychiatrist) who lists LGBTQIA+ care as a specialty and describes their affirming approach in their bio.

Pasadena sits within the greater Houston metro area, which means you may have access to providers both locally and across Harris County through virtual appointments. When comparing providers, consider what matters most to you — whether that's a specific therapeutic approach, shared lived experience, or availability that fits your schedule. Reading a provider's full bio can help you understand their style and decide if they're a good match before booking.
